AC Servo Motor Overview

AC servo motors (alternating current servo motors) are high-performance motors capable of precisely controlling position, speed, and torque. They serve as core drive components in high-end manufacturing sectors such as automation equipment, robotics, and precision machine tools.

Unlike conventional motors, the essence of servo motors lies in the term "servo," meaning "to follow" or "to obey control." They can rapidly and accurately execute commands issued by controllers.

Key Features

🎯

High Precision

Achieves angular-second level position control accuracy thanks to high-resolution encoders (e.g., 17-bit, 23-bit).

Rapid Response

Extremely short response times for start, stop, and speed changes enable high-speed command processing.

🔄

Wide Speed Range

Smooth operation across extremely low to extremely high speed ranges with excellent stability.

💪

Strong Overload Capacity

Capable of handling instantaneous overloads several times the rated torque to withstand heavy load impacts.

Industrial Applications

  • ✔ Industrial Robots: Joint-driven systems requiring precise positioning.
  • ✔ CNC Machine Tools: Spindle and feed axis drives ensuring machining accuracy.
  • ✔ Semiconductor Equipment: Wafer handling and lithography demanding ultra-high precision.
  • ✔ Packaging & Printing: Executing complex synchronized and flying shear operations.
